Visiting SeaWorld San Diego
SeaWorld San Diego in San Diego did not start as a theme park. The original concept was actually an underwater restaurant. The plan was so ambitious that it was technically impossible to build at the time. It eventually evolved into a public aquarium and zoological park, which finally opened its doors in 1964.
The SeaWorld chain
In 1970, a second park opened in Ohio, followed by Orlando in 1973 and San Antonio in 1988. All of these locations are under the ownership of SeaWorld Parks & Entertainment.
The attractions
SeaWorld is primarily a place for entertainment, and you can find plenty of thrills on the park's roller coasters. You can take a water ride on inner tubes or enjoy one of the many amusement rides.
You can even experience a marine-themed adventure at the 4D theater that opened in the park in 2008.
However, SeaWorld also functions as a place for learning and connecting with marine wildlife.
Attractions such as Orca Encounter, Dolphin Days, and Sea Lions Live are more than just entertainment. They allow you to learn more about these aquatic animals, which are often misunderstood.
Of course, there are many aquariums to visit where you can get a close look at the residents, from sea turtles and sharks to stingrays and tropical fish.
Do not let your kids miss Otter Outlook. This otter habitat consistently provides an entertaining and charming display.
Special programs
For an additional fee, the park allows you to interact with the animals. You can go behind the scenes, shadow the trainers in their work, or help feed dolphins, penguins, or sea lions.
The VIP tour even provides a private guide who will take you closer to the animals and introduce you to the park's professional staff.
